Where Caution Is Advised
While the Teacher Assistant Quote Retro Svg Design is versatile, there are certain applications where it might not deliver the desired results:
- Small Hoop Sizes: The design has moderate width, so it may require resizing for smaller hoops. Be sure to inspect how the lettering holds up at reduced scales — tiny strokes might get lost in the stitch count.
- Stretchy or Textured Fabrics: On stretchy materials like spandex or textured fabrics like denim, the smooth flow of the font could become distorted if not stabilized properly. Always test on scrap before committing to production.
- Dark Fabric Backgrounds: The design lacks high contrast by default. While it works well on light-colored garments, consider using bright thread colors to ensure visibility on darker substrates.
- Curved Surfaces (e.g., Caps or Hats): Due to the nature of curved embroidery, long horizontal lines can warp slightly. If used on a cap, the design should be split or adjusted for better alignment.
- Dense Stitch Areas: If you’re combining this with other fill or satin stitch elements, be mindful of stitch density. Overlapping dense areas can cause puckering or distortion, especially on thinner materials.
Design Notes for Optimal Results
To maximize the performance of the Teacher Assistant Quote Retro Svg Design, here are a few practical tips:
- Test on Scrap Fabric First: Before embroidering a client’s project or a batch for your boutique, run a sample. See how the stitches lay, whether the corners hold, and if the lettering remains legible.
- Check Thread Color Contrast: Especially for personalized gifts, the right thread color can make all the difference. Consider using metallic or pastel shades for a more decorative look.
- Review Stitch Density: This design doesn’t appear overly dense, but depending on the machine and settings, it may need adjustment for optimal stitch coverage and durability.
- Confirm Hoop Size Requirements: Though specific hoop sizes aren't provided, it’s likely suited for medium to large hoops. For precise measurements, always refer to the file instructions or check the design layer dimensions in your software.
- Inspect Small Details: Look closely at the apostrophes and punctuation marks. They should remain clear and intact after stitching, especially when resized.
- Use Proper Stabilizer: For thin or stretchy fabrics, a tear-away or cut-away stabilizer will help keep the design crisp and prevent warping.
- Verify Licensing Terms: If you plan to sell finished products or digital assets, confirm the licensing allows for commercial use. This is crucial for Etsy sellers and craft business owners.
